Thermal Comfort Strategies for Raised Flooring

At the heart of any effective thermal management strategy lie the inherent properties of the raised access flooring system itself. ​The load-bearing capacity, pedestal adjustment range, and panel design all play a crucial role in facilitating airflow, heat distribution, and occupant comfort.

Load Capacity: Heavier-duty raised flooring systems, often specified for commercial environments, allow for the integration of underfloor air distribution (UFAD) and radiant heating/cooling systems. These advanced HVAC solutions leverage the void space beneath the floor to deliver conditioned air or thermal energy directly to the occupied zone, enhancing overall efficiency and thermal comfort.

Pedestal Adjustment: The ability to precisely level and height-adjust access floor pedestals is essential for maintaining even airflow and eliminating potential hot or cold spots. This flexibility ensures an unimpeded path for conditioned air, whether delivered through discrete UFAD outlets or dispersed through a permeable floor panel design.

Panel Design: Perforated, slotted, or varied-density access floor panels can further optimise thermal comfort by regulating airflow and heat transfer. Strategically placed high-airflow panels, for example, allow cool air to be directed towards occupancy zones, while solid panels over heat-generating equipment help contain warm air where it is needed most.

Beyond the core flooring components, the overall system integration and construction detailing are crucial factors in achieving optimal thermal performance. Careful consideration of factors like underfloor insulation, air-sealing, and cable management can significantly impact the efficiency and effectiveness of the HVAC system.

Enhancing Thermal Comfort Through HVAC Integration

Integrating raised access flooring with the building’s HVAC system is a powerful strategy for creating tailored thermal environments. ​Underfloor air distribution (UFAD), in particular, has emerged as a preferred solution for many commercial and public facilities, offering several advantages over conventional overhead air systems.

Underfloor Air Distribution: UFAD systems supply conditioned air through discrete floor-level outlets, allowing for greater control over airflow, temperature, and ventilation rates within the occupied zone. This targeted approach can significantly improve thermal comfort, reduce energy consumption, and enhance indoor air quality.

By delivering cool air at lower velocities and warmer air at higher levels, UFAD systems take advantage of natural thermal stratification, minimising the mixing of hot and cold air. This results in more efficient, even cooling and heating, with reduced risk of drafts or uneven temperatures.

Radiant Heating and Cooling: Integrating radiant systems within the raised access flooring void can provide an effective means of delivering thermal energy directly to occupants. ​Radiant panels embedded in the underfloor void or within the floor panels themselves can efficiently heat or cool the space, leveraging the large surface area to create a comfortable, uniform thermal environment.

Crucially, the ability to independently control HVAC zoning and airflow within raised access flooring systems allows for greater customisation and responsiveness to the needs of diverse user groups. ​Retail stores, hospitality lounges, and leisure facilities often require tailored thermal comfort solutions to accommodate varied occupancy patterns, activities, and equipment loads.

Optimising Thermal Comfort Through Design

While the technical performance of the raised access flooring system is paramount, the overall design of the space can have a significant impact on thermal comfort. Careful consideration of factors like air movement, solar gain, and occupant behaviour can help create an environment that is not only thermally efficient but also responsive to the unique needs of each project.

Air Movement: Strategically locating floor-level air supply grilles and returns can enhance air circulation and prevent the formation of stagnant zones. ​Similarly, raised access floor panels with varied perforation patterns or openings can be used to direct airflow towards high-density occupancy areas or specific thermal loads.

Solar Gain: In retail, hospitality, and leisure facilities with extensive glazing, managing solar heat gain is crucial. Integrating raised access flooring with external shading devices, internal blinds, or thermal-blocking films can help regulate temperatures and minimise the need for overcooling.

Occupant Behaviour: Understanding the expected use patterns and activity levels within a space is essential for optimising thermal comfort. ​Raised access flooring systems that allow for individualised temperature control, whether through desktop vents or smartphone apps, can empower occupants to tailor their personal comfort levels, reducing the likelihood of complaints and improving overall satisfaction.

Ensuring Regulatory Compliance

Alongside the technical and design-led considerations for optimising thermal comfort, it is essential to ensure that raised access flooring systems comply with the relevant safety, accessibility, and sustainability standards.

Safety Standards: In the UK, raised access flooring must adhere to the BS EN 12825 standard, which sets out requirements for structural integrity, load-bearing capacity, and fire safety. Careful selection of components and installation techniques is crucial to meet these regulatory obligations.

Accessibility Guidelines: The Equality Act 2010 and associated Approved Document M outline accessibility requirements for commercial buildings. Raised access flooring systems must be designed and installed to accommodate the needs of all users, including those with physical disabilities, ensuring level transitions, appropriate gap sizes, and slip-resistant surfaces.

Sustainability Requirements: As the industry increasingly prioritises environmental performance, raised access flooring systems must demonstrate strong credentials in areas like energy efficiency, indoor air quality, and material sustainability. Compliance with green building standards, such as BREEAM or LEED, can help ensure that thermal comfort strategies align with broader sustainability goals.
